Few would argue that in order for a business to sustain its success, there has to be value beyond the mere product or service it brings to the market place. Every business has intrinsic value embedded within its assets. Some of these might be overt while others might be hidden and less obvious. Here are a few examples: the holder of a patent, a great URL for a website, or a retail store’s location would be considered remarkable key resources. Hypothetical Business Scenario
